It's the annual Western Halloween again. On October 23rd, Eiichiro Oda showed his own Halloween commemorative art. The new costume of the heroine Utahime designed by Oda was unveiled. The official also announced that there will be a special video of Utahime in the "One Piece" TV animation on Halloween Eve on October 30th. Stay tuned.

•"One Piece: The Red-Haired Diva" is the 15th animated film in the series. It was released in Japan on August 6. So far, the box office has exceeded 17 billion yen, which has already reached the highest box office record of the "One Piece" series of animated films.

• "One Piece: Red-Haired Diva" is directed by Goro Taniguchi, written by Tsutomu Kuroiwa, and produced by Eiichiro Oda. The story revolves around the biggest key character in the series, Red-Haired Shanks, and his daughter with extraordinary powers. It will also hint at many new clues about the direction of the final chapter of the comic version of "One Piece".
